Following is the Trial Balance for the year ended 31st March, 2021
Prepare Trading and Profit and Loss Account for the period ending 31st March, 2021 and
a Balance Sheet as on that date after taking following information into consideration.
1. Closing stock Rs. 80,200 (including stationery stocks Rs. 200).
2. Office expenses include stationery purchased Rs.800.
3. Sundry Debtors include Rs.3,000 receivable from Reeta and Sundry Creditors include
Rs.1,000 payable to Reeta.
4. A sum of Rs.5,000 has been received from a debtor as deposit which has been credited
to his account
5. Rs.500 were written off as bad debts in previous year and this amount has been
received during the current year and has been credited to Debtors Account.
6. Some employees are residing in the premises of business due to their nature of
service, the rent of such portion is Rs.1,000 per month.
7. Salaries include a sum of Rs.500 which is advance salary.
8. On 1st April, 2020 books contain such furniture of Rs.600 which was sold for Rs.290 on
30th Sept., 2020 and in exchange of it a new furniture of Rs.520 was acquired, its net
invoice of Rs.230 was recorded in purchase books.
9. Depreciate Buildings @ 5% p.a. and Furniture @ 10% p.a. 10. Goods worth Rs. 2,000
were in transit on the last day of the accounting yea

Task III
You have been asked to work with a start- up business that your firm has just taken on as
client. The business is particular in need of support and guidance with budgeting and how it
can be used to inform efficient resource allocation and support effective control and decision-
making. The founder of the business is investing $100,000 of their own capital and has also
secured business loan of $50,000
(Note: student should prepare the budget in spreadsheet and the data will be given)
You have been asked to prepare a memorandum that includes the following.
From the information below, prepare a cash budget for a company for April, May, and June
2021 in a columnar form.
● An evaluation of the role that budgets play in the effective planning and control of resources in an
organisation such as your client’s. This will include both benefits and any limitations of using budgets
and the extent to which they can help identify problems and corrective actions.
● An outline of a range of budgetary control solutions, with justification, to support organisation
decision making and ensure efficient and effective deployment of resources
